DIY bathroom fitting can be a rewarding project, especially in Birmingham where local styles and features can inspire your design. Start by creating a detailed plan, including layouts and a list of materials you'll need. For a standard renovation, expect to spend around £1,500–£3,000 on essentials like tiles, fixtures, and plumbing supplies. Remember, the costs can vary based on your choices and whether you're converting to a wet room or installing an en-suite.
## Steps to Follow: 1. Planning: Measure your space and decide what changes you want. 2. Demolition: Carefully remove old fixtures; ensure you turn off the water supply. 3. Plumbing: If you're not qualified, consider hiring a Gas Safe registered plumber for any gas-related installations. 4. Installation: Follow the building regulations; it’s crucial to ensure that your wiring and plumbing are up to code. NICEIC certified electricians can assist with electrical fittings.
If you're unfamiliar with plumbing or electrical work, it's wise to consult a professional to avoid costly mistakes.
